About this artwork
This picture represents a "fake cabinet" that at first glance has all the characteristics of a cabinet, but at second glance is not really functional. Everything is there, drawers, handles, lattice windows with mysterious contents, hinges, locks and hooks for closing. Everything seems to be somewhat clumsily put together from various found objects and materials and everything seems to block each other. This picture is mounted on a thick stretcher… frame to increase the three-dimensional effect of the picture. So it does not need a frame.
The appeal of this picture lies in its actually abstract composition, in which something recognizable appears again and again, memories are addressed through surface structure and plasticity, but these memories repeatedly fail in the attempt to create a coherent function.
The title "All-rounder" ironically refers to such an impossible self-portrayal

Thomas Johannsmeier is an experienced painter and a draftsman whose works have been exhibited nationally, as well as in Russia, the Netherlands, and France. In his compositions, classical portaits are taken out of their contexts and contrasted with elements of modern art, which consists of monochrome colors, graffiti, photos, patterns, or quotations from other images. Johannsmeier most often creates using acrylics and oils on canvas.
